Job Summary

  • The Director of Staff Development is responsible for planning and implementing facility orientation, job skills training, in-service education, and a Certification Training Program for nursing assistants.
  • This role involves working with the Director of Nursing and Administrator to ensure the highest degree of quality care and provides direct resident/patient care.
  • Key duties include coordinating staff recruitment and hiring, managing payroll and benefits, planning and conducting drills, and supervising staff.
